There are several spots on a genuine Ray-Ban product that should include Ray-Ban logo. As you can see in this eyerim unboxing video below, the classic legendary Ray-Ban logo is always nice and visible on the lenses.
Lenses: Majority of Ray-Ban products include an ‘RB’ etched onto the left lens right next to the hinge. If you own polarized version, ‘Discounted aviator sunglasses Ray-Ban P’ should be engraved in the top corner of the right lens, as well. If "P" is missing be cautious, your sunglasses are either not polarized, or authentic.
Ray-Ban products also include a high-quality sticker with Ray-Ban logo that sticks to the lens by static. Any signs of glue under the sticker may indicate fake.
Nose pads: Metal Ray-Ban sunglasses usually have these transparent nose pads that sit on your nose. Again, you can spot ‘RB’ letter combination embossed into their centre.
When you check temples carefully, raybans sunglasses sale uk they should include some information about your product right on the inside left temple arm - model number and size details. Some models such as Ray-Ban Wayfarer, or Ray-Ban Justin also have a ‘Ray-Ban’ badge attached to the temple. Check the badge, it should be small and attached with pins, rather than glued.
